does using FTZ affect crop ratio?

I'm looking into switching to full frame and as i'm already decently invested into the Nikon ecosystem, the Z series seems to make the most sense. Being that I already have quite a few DX lenses, i'm curious as to how the FTZ adaptor affects the quality. Would using a DX lens therefore "crop" the sensor, or does the adaptor make up for the difference and essentially turn the DX lens into an FX lens?

Sorry if this is a silly question, I'm fairly new to the world of anything beyond crop sensor cameras & lenses, any feedback is greatly appreciated!
 
The FTZ does not change the field of view at all. The DX lens will still image at the DX size. I use several F-mount DX lenses with the FTZ. All behave exactly as they did on F-mount.
 
The FTZ is basically a spacer, it maintains the distance from the sensor of a Z camera to the lens mounting flange of an F-mount lens; compare how shallow the depth of the sensor of a Z-mount camera is to an F-mount.

Some DX zoom lenses can be used on FX though maybe not across their full range (12-24DX for example is good from 18-24 on FX) but on a Z camera a DX lens will always use the DX crop, not possible to override it to FX.

I have not used an F-mount DX lens in a very long time but with Nikkor Z lenses made for DX format cameras the FX format Z cameras the camera automatically locks into DX crop mode, no ifs, ands, or buts.

From a 2020 thread, worth re-posting. The FTZ moves the DSLR lenses out to the correct distance so it can focus on the sensor, and passes the electrical signals through.

This cross section shows how the mirror assembly requires the sensor to be farther from the lens. I just posted it because it's interesting how everything is packed into a small space.

Both cameras are aligned at the lens mount ring. On the Z, the sensor is very close.
